Yes and I have some additional fuses too - rear seat adjustment for example.
BUT that fuse I'd always assumed was for the amplifiers in the rear speakers, so that's probably why you have no sound from the back.
With Bose, there's a separate amplifier (as described under the CD changer) but with non-Bose the amplifiers are less powerful and are attached to the rear parcel shelf speakers. Take the covers off beneath them and you'll see.
In both cases these also drive the speakers in the rear doors, which are the MAIN rear sound, the parcel shelf ones are purely for bass notes.
The front speakers are driven directly from the head unit, I think maybe even with Bose installed.
